Videos
Tour
Music
Store
Gear
Psychostick: Terrible Shirt Tour - Video Blog 2
Psychostick goes to Odessa Texas! We ate cookies, bought video games and even played a show!
Subscribe to Psychostick on
Youtube
If Alex became a zombie, we'd be fucked.